Abstract

The present invention provides method, system, equipment and the storage medium that tourism places an order, including step:Order is established, order includes order number, internal order process number and tourism product integration, and order number establishes mapping relations with unique internal order process number, and internal order process number establishes mapping relations with unique tourism product integration;Judge whether order is changed, if then more new order, updated order includes original order number, newly-generated inside order process number and newly-generated tourism product integration, original order number establishes new mapping relations with unique newly-generated inside order process number, newly-generated inside order process number establishes new mapping relations with newly-generated tourism product integration, when judging that order will be paid for, the price generation paying bill of the tourism product integration corresponding to the order process number of inside according to corresponding to order number, therefore it does not need to carry out complicated data transfer, improve operational efficiency, reduce error generation rate.

Background technology
The process to place an order of travelling is different from lower single process of other field, it usually needs by complicated order processing step Suddenly, it needs to preserve a large amount of data, while there is a situation where that user is frequently necessary to be modified order again.In the prior art, It is checked in order to facilitate user, the front and rear order number of usual user's change remains unchanged, and passes through complicated data transfer on backstage Afterwards, it updates the data in the database, such method is there are order processing step is numerous and diverse, and treatment effeciency is low, and order data is more Newly easy the problem of mistake occurs, especially operates comparatively fast when user changes, and background data base update is not in time, it is easier to occur The problem of order payment error.

Fig. 1 is the flow chart of method that the tourism of one embodiment of the invention places an order.As shown in Figure 1, under the tourism of the present invention Single method, includes the following steps:
S11, order is established.
Specifically, after the order for receiving user submits information, an order is established, order includes a newly-generated use The visible order number in family, the sightless internal order process number of a newly-generated user and tourism product integration, order number with Unique internal order process number establishes mapping relations, and internal order process number is established mapping with unique tourism product integration and closed System.Tourism product integration refers to multiple travelling products in an order, and travelling products include hotel, air ticket, sight spot etc..With Family identifies order, even if later stage user modifies to the content of the travelling products of the order, order by unique order number Number it will not change, consequently facilitating user is checked by order number, manages order.Newly-generated internal order process number, for As the mark of order inter-process, the tourism product integration in the sequence information that internal order process number is submitted with active user Corresponding, there are one-to-one relationships with current tourism product integration for internal order process number.Order number by internal order into Journey number establishes mapping relations with tourism product integration.
Preferably, the order of user is submitted information to be converted to extensible markup language by the present embodiment, without will directly order It is single that information is submitted to be stored in background data base in real time.Since the characteristics of tourism order is that order data content is more, usually order for one Singly it is related to the data of 50 multiple tables, order submission information is directly stored in background data base in real time, there are in any one table Data once preserve failure if user place an order failure the problem of.Order submission information is converted into extensible markup language, with It realizes temporarily storage, information and date library is submitted to preserve decoupling so as to fulfill the order for receiving user, lost even if database preserves It loses, user will not be caused to place an order unsuccessfully.
S12, the multiple sub- orders of generation simultaneously store.
Since there are multiple travelling products, in order to preferably carry out the processing of each travelling products, it is preferably carried out step S12 generates multiple sub- orders according to internal order process number and corresponding tourism product integration, and each sub- order corresponds to one The information of internal order process number and sub- order corresponding with internal order process number is stored in back-end data by travelling products Library.
Preferably, the extensible markup language in analyzing step S11, extraction parsing after travelling products information using as The information of internal order process number and sub- order is stored in background data base by the information of sub- order.
It should be noted that complete in step s 12 internal order process number and with the inside order process number pair The information for the sub- order answered preserves, even if subsequent user is modified order, also no longer secondary storage is same in subsequent step The information of one inside order process number and corresponding sub- order will not occur to carry out the former data of database preserved It preserves or changes again, so as to avoid the mistake that places an order caused by Database error.
S13, judge whether order is changed, if so then execute step S14, if otherwise performing step S15;
S14, more new order.
Specifically, the order received after user's change submits information, more new order, updated order includes original Order number, a newly-generated inside order process number and newly-generated tourism product integration, original order number with it is unique Newly-generated inside order process number establishes new mapping relations, and newly-generated inside order process number is produced with newly-generated tourism New mapping relations are established in product combination.That is, when user changes order contents, the visible order number of user is constant, and One new inside order process number is generated according to current tourism product integration, by order number and newly-generated inside order into Journey number establishes new mapping relations, since the mapping relations of order number and internal order process number are unique, order numbers With original inside order process number no longer there are mapping relations, and establish mapping with newly-generated inside order process number and close System updates so as to realize order by internal order process number.
After order update, new internal order process number is generated, step S12 is performed again and generates multiple sub- orders and deposit Storage, i.e., when user is modified order, update of not modifying in the database to former data, but ordered in the new inside of storage One process number and sub- sequence information corresponding with new inside order process number.
S15, judge whether order will be paid for, enter generation paying bill if so then execute step S17, if otherwise returning to step Rapid S15.
For the accuracy of support price, step S16 is preferably carried out before step S17, carries out price monitoring.Fig. 2 is The detail flowchart of step S16 in Fig. 1, as shown in Fig. 2, step S16 includes step:S161, monitor travelling products price be It is no to there is variation, step S162 is performed if changing, does not change and performs step S164.S162, interruption place an order, and send Prompt message is to user.S163, field feedback is received, judges whether user agrees to the price after variation, held if agreeing to Row step S164 if disagreed, performs step S165.S164, confirmation message is sent, it is pre- to carry out the travelling products of sub- order It is fixed.S165 terminates order and places an order.
The longer operating time is needed since tourism order usually places an order, the price fluctuation of travelling products is again relatively frequent, because This can effectively ensure that the accuracy of travelling products price by step S16, reduce order processing mistake.
The price generation branch of tourism product integration corresponding to S17, the inside order process number according to corresponding to order number Fu Dan, so that user is paid.
Step S17 includes step in the present embodiment:S171, the inside order process number institute according to corresponding to order number are right The price generation paying bill for the tourism product integration answered.Since order number and internal order process number are uniquely corresponding, internal order Process number is uniquely corresponding with tourism product integration, therefore the valency of current tourism product integration has been uniquely determined by order process number Lattice, and paying bill is generated, order process number is contained in paying bill.
After S172, paying bill are paid for, sub- order is confirmed according to the corresponding internal order process number of paying bill, is gone forward side by side The travelling products of the sub- order of row make a reservation for.After user's payment finishes current paying bill, due to including order process number in paying bill, Therefore the sub- order corresponding with order process number being paid for can be uniquely determined according to order process number, and carry out son and order Travelling products in list make a reservation for.Therefore, predetermined mistake can effectively be avoided by the label of order process number and transmission.
The first completion user payment of difference in this present embodiment, then carry out the travelling products of sub- order and make a reservation for, in another reality It applies in example, the travelling products that sub- order is first carried out in step S17 make a reservation for, then carry out user's payment, and S17 specifically includes step: The travelling products that S173, the inside order process number according to corresponding to order number carry out sub- order make a reservation for.S174, according to sub- order Paying bill is generated, so that user is paid, paying bill includes the corresponding internal order process number of sub- order.In the embodiment In, label and transmission again by internal order process number so as to uniquely determine sub- order and paying bill, effectively avoid order Mistake.
S20, asynchronous operation perform.In order to improve operational efficiency, reasonable distribution server resource, in the process that tourism places an order In, part operation is no longer performed by current server in single process under tourism, and is placed an order stream in tourism by external server It is performed other than journey, such operation is known as asynchronous operation, and asynchronous operation for example confirms short message including being sent to user, receives user Confirmation message sends circular mail of sub- sequence information etc. to user.
Fig. 3 is the detail flowchart of step S20 in Fig. 1, as shown in figure 3, step S20 includes step:S201, message is created Queue generates asynchronous process request according to order, asynchronous process request and information is stored in message queue.S202, general Message queue is sent to execute server.Execute server reads asynchronous process request and information in message queue, performs different Step operation.S203, execute server is received according to the execution feedback information of message queue execution asynchronous operation and is stored in backstage In database.Confirm the request of short message asynchronous process for example, generating and sending according to order, and will send and confirm that short message asynchronous process please It asks and sequence information is included in user information in message queue, the transmission that short message server is read in message queue confirms short Believe asynchronous process request and sequence information and user information, short message server sends acknowledgement of orders short message to user, receives short The execution feedback information of telecommunications services device is simultaneously stored in background data base.
It is performed other than single process under tourism by external server by step S20 so as to divide asynchronous operation, no It needs to open asynchronous thread calling interface again so that the lower single process of tourism no longer needs to stop to wait for, and improves tourism and places an order place Efficiency is managed, asynchronous operation is handled by external server, server resource is had effectively achieved and distributes rationally.Pass through message queue Storage processing request and information, effectively realize using decoupling.
In the present embodiment, step S20 is performed after step S17, is not limited to above-mentioned steps in other embodiments and is held Row order, can also after other steps, it is preceding or be performed simultaneously, need to only meet and be performed after step S11.
By the description of the above-mentioned method to place an order to tourism of the invention it is found that the present invention is receiving ordering for user each time It is single submit information after, all generate the sightless internal order process number of a user, and pass through internal order process number with it is current Tourism product integration in order establishes unique mapping, and when user's update plans single, order number and newly-generated inside are ordered One process number is associated with, and is updated so as to fulfill order.Due to introducing internal order process number, do not need to carry out complicated number According to transmission, it is not required that database Central Plains data are modified update, so as to simplify flow, improve processing speed and operation Efficiency effectively reduces error generation rate.
The present invention also provides a kind of system traveled and placed an order, the system which places an order changes the trip of order for user After swimming product content, it usually needs it carries out complicated order data and transmits, and former data are modified update in the database, So as to cause order processing step numerous and diverse, treatment effeciency is low, and the problem of wrong easily occurs, is generated by order management module Internal order process number, internal order process number establish unique mapping with the tourism product integration in current order, in user more When newly planning single, order number with newly-generated inside order process number is associated with, is updated so as to fulfill order, improving efficiency reduces Error generation rate.The system to place an order for existing tourism is excessively high there is also coupling, exists and erroneous effects locally once occur The problem of whole system, realizes decoupling by message module and external message queue.
Fig. 4 is the module diagram of system for including tourism and placing an order of one embodiment of the invention, and Fig. 5 is that the present invention one is implemented The data flow schematic diagram of system that the tourism of example places an order.With reference to Fig. 4 and Fig. 5 to the system that the tourism of the present invention places an order into Row explanation.
The system 10 that places an order of tourism of the present invention respectively with user 20, background data base 31, message queue 32 and multiple 33 data connection of execute server submits information to carry out tourism and places an order according to the order of user 20.The system 10 to place an order of travelling is wrapped Include predetermined module 11, order management module 12, at least one sub- order module 13, payment module 14, price module 15, message mould Block 16.
The order that predetermined module 11 is used to receive user submits the order after information and user's change to submit information.
For order management module 12 for establishing an order, order includes a newly-generated visible order number of user, one newly The sightless internal order process number of user and tourism product integration of generation, order number and unique internal order process number Mapping relations are established, internal order process number establishes mapping relations with unique tourism product integration.Order management module 12 exists After receiving the order submission information after user's change, more new order, updated order includes original order number, and one is newly-generated Inside order process number and newly-generated tourism product integration, original order number and unique newly-generated inside order Process number establishes new mapping relations, and newly-generated inside order process number establishes new reflect with newly-generated tourism product integration Penetrate relationship.
Sub- order module 13 is used to be ordered according to internal order process number and the multiple sons of corresponding tourism product integration generation Single, each sub- order corresponds to a travelling products, and the information of internal order process number and corresponding sub- order is stored in Background data base 31.
Payment module 14 is for the tourism product integration corresponding to the inside order process number according to corresponding to order number Price generates paying bill, so that user is paid.
Price module 15 is used to monitor the price of travelling products with the presence or absence of variation, changes, interruption places an order, and sends Prompt message is to user.Price module 15 receives the feedback information whether user agrees to change price, passes through order if agreeing to Management module 12 to sub- order module 13 send confirmation message, made a reservation for the travelling products for carrying out sub- order, if disagreeing to Order management module 12, which is sent, terminates order placement information, and the end of order management module 12 places an order.
Message module 16 is used to create message queue 32.Message module 16 generates asynchronous process request according to order, will be different Step processing request and tourism order placement information are stored in message queue 32.Message queue 32 is sent to execution by message module 16 Server 33 is read asynchronous process request and tourism order placement information in message queue 32 by execute server 33, performed different Step operation.Message module 16 receives execute server 33 and performs the execution feedback information of asynchronous operation, and will perform feedback information It is stored in background data base 31.It is not included in due to message queue 32 in the system 10 that tourism places an order, it is achieved that asynchronous Operation with the decoupling of system 10 that places an order of tourism, that is, other modules in the system 10 to place an order of travelling will not with message queue 32 or It is that external execute server 33 has an impact from each other, avoids generation once asking for erroneous effects whole system locally occurs Topic.
Fig. 5 shows a kind of embodiment of single data flow under tourism for each inside order process number.Such as Shown in Fig. 5, the order that predetermined module 11 receives user first submits information, and sends order and submit information to order management module 12.Order management module 12 establishes order, and sends internal order process number to corresponding at least one sub- order module 13.Son Order module 13 generates sub- order, and the information of internal order process number and corresponding sub- order is stored in back-end data Library 31.Price module 15 is monitored adjustment by order management module 12 to the price of travelling products.Order management module 12 When judging that order is paid for, internal order process number is sent to order module.Payment module 14 is according to internal order process number institute The price generation paying bill of corresponding tourism product integration, so that user is paid, and to order after user's payment finishes The transmission of management module 12, which is paid, successfully feeds back.Order management module 12 includes internal order process number to the transmission of sub- order module 13 The sub- sequence information of confirmation.The travelling products that sub- order module 13 carries out sub- order according to internal order process number make a reservation for.
